Lighting a Campfire
Once you have decided on the type of campfire and collected the tinder-kindling-fuel you need lighting a campfire can be broken down into four basic steps.  Over time, with practice and experimentation you can improve your campfire lighting skills, producing a good fire in all conditions and using less then ideal materials but these four basic steps are a good starting point.
